The Law is clear: When the 7 Seals are broken 4 Horsemen shall Ride fourth to punish the wicked, be they Lords of Heaven, Dregs of Hell or The Sons of Man!  The Seals have been broken, and now the 4 Horsemen ride upon the ruined earth.  When they arrive, Death, Strife and War are shocked by the news that Fury had been playing protector that there still remains a group of humans.  War shares his own stories of The Destroyer's true identity, Death explains his journey to restore Humanity, and the death of Absalom, also corruption.  As for Strife... he shares the stories of Haven, before Fury's arrival, and his journeys after.  When all stories are done being told, all 4 ride across the earth, searching for the truth of why they were betrayed by the Council, While Strife insists that they side with Humanity in the true Endwar, Death and War insist on serving the balance, and Fury cares only for revenge against their former Masters.  All other manner of factions remain however.  Alliances between Faction leaders have been made, and when Samael and Lilith make a claim to fill the power vacuum left by The Destroyer, Uriel and Azrael must rally the remnants of The Hellguard to fight.  In an effort to judge effectively, Death orders The Horsemen to split into teams, Fury and War shall be one, Death and Strife another.  As the group goes about their duties, they decide they can no longer follow blindly, and must decide whom they will aid in the Endwar.  Before all of this however, we flashback to Strife's journeys before his brother and sister join him on the wartorn earth, both during the events of his Fury's first visit, and before his mysterious disappearance and arrival with the other Horsemen.
